Handover note — TideTrace widget

Passing this to whoever maintains TideTrace next. The widget pulls harbor predictions from our Marrowport cache; the cache signing store is sealed and must be unsealed after every host reboot, or tides render as flat lines. The unseal script is in ops/unseal.sh and prompts once. When it asks, supply the recovery passphrase given below.

recovery phrase for fawif-tajeg: norael-aldmir-casir-brivan-ulaion

Briefing: Pinefold Pilot — Churn Update

Quick read for the board: churn in the Pinefold pilot hit 14% in month three, roughly double forecast. Exit surveys point to onboarding friction, not pricing. Sorrel's team is reworking the first-week flow and early retention nudges look promising at the Varnmouth cohort.

We recommend extending the pilot one quarter. The fuller picture follows below.

management briefing: Sorvanox Systems plans to raise the Zorwyn list price by 27.2 percent in December. The pricing group signed off on a budget of $101.7 million for Project Casox. The renewal with Pramirix Foods closes at $183.4 million a year, 63.5 percent above the last contract. Project Holdor slips by one quarter because of the tooling delay.

Welcome aboard. Before you touch any deploy for the Stelliform platform, please read this carefully. Our canary gating rules are strict by design: a canary must run for thirty minutes, hold error rates below baseline plus one percent, and pass the synthetic checkout probe before promotion. Gates cannot be overridden without sign-off from the release captain, even for urgent fixes. The complete rule table, including per-service thresholds and exemption procedures, is maintained on this page.

runbook for badug-kadup: https://confluence.zemvarlabs.internal/projects/browse/display/projects/bd1b

The reminder job for Brightfen Clinic runs under the svc-reminders account and calls the internal Pagewren scheduling API every 15 minutes. Plugin authors extending reminder templates must authenticate through the same account; per-plugin accounts are not issued. Rate limits are shared, so batch your calls. To run the job locally against staging, authenticate with the key shown below.

app token of kagap-fahag = zpat2_0m